Pep Guardiola makes six changes to Manchester City XI for Manchester derby

The Citizens, who beat Peterborough United in the FA Cup on Tuesday, will be looking to move six points clear at the top of the Premier League and claim their first home win against the Red Devils since November 2018

Injured centre-backs Ruben Dias and Nathan Ake are among the players not selected this afternoon, while Oleksandr Zinehcnko, Fernandinho, Ilkay Gundogan and Gabriel Jesus all drop to the substitutes’ bench after starting in midweek.

 

Joining Stones and Laoprte in defence, Kyle Walker returns at right-back, allowing Joao Cancelo to switch to left-back, while Rodri replaces Fernandinho as the sole pivot, with playmakers Kevin De Bruyne and Bernardo Silva joining the Spaniard in centre-midfield.

 

Stockport-born Phil Foden operated in a three-man midfield in midweek, but he starts in the attacking front three this afternoon, with Riyad Mahrez on the right flank and Raheem Sterling – who is still searching for his first ever goal against Man United at the 24th attempt – to begin on the left wing.

Academy graduates Lima Delap, James McAtee and Luke Mbete are al names on the substitutes bench.
